What they do
A Cable Technician or Installer sets up cable equipment and lines for customers and makes repairs as needed.

Traveling Install Technician CRV Surveillance Birmingham, AL Job Details Full-time 1 day ago Qualifications Customer communication Outdoor work experience Driver's License Full Job Description About CRV Surveillance Our customer's protection is our priority. That philosophy has led to exponential growth since we were founded in 2010. Corey Varden, Owner/CEO, started the company to help fill a need he saw to provide superior security options for businesses at a competitive price. Our core business consists of creating custom-designed security solutions for our customers. We install, maintain, monitor, and inspect a wide range of integrated building protection systems, including access control, video camera surveillance, fire alarms, and burglar alarms. We prioritize service after the sale because we want to ensure our security solutions exceed our customer's expectations, not just for today, but for years to come. e are seeking a dependable and motivated Low Voltage Technician to join our growing team. This position is ideal for someone with hands-on low-voltage experience who is comfortable working independently, working as part of a field team, and traveling regularly to project locations . The Low Voltage Technician will be responsible for the installation, service, troubleshooting, and maintenance of low-voltage systems while maintaining company quality and safety standards. Responsibilities Install, terminate, test, troubleshoot, and service low-voltage cabling and equipment. Perform structured cabling installations, including Cat5e, Cat6, fiber, and related infrastructure. Install and service systems such as: Video surveillance / CCTV Access control Intrusion detection Fire alarm systems, when properly licensed/certified Data and network cabling Other low-voltage systems as assigned Read and follow project drawings, plans, specifications, and scopes of work. Properly label, test, document, and maintain installed systems. Use hand tools, power tools, ladders, and lifts safely. Communicate project progress, site conditions, material needs, and potential issues to project leadership. Maintain company tools, equipment, and vehicles in a professional manner. Complete required job documentation accurately and on time. Follow company policies, customer site requirements, and all applicable safety procedures. Work cooperatively with project managers, coordinators, other technicians, subcontractors, and customers. Travel to job sites as required, including overnight and multi-day travel. Qualifications Previous low-voltage installation or service experience preferred. Experience with security, access control, surveillance, structured cabling, fire alarm, or similar systems is highly preferred. Ability to terminate and test low-voltage cabling. Ability to troubleshoot installation and equipment issues in the field. Ability to read basic drawings, schematics, and project documentation. Strong communication and problem-solving skills. Dependable, organized, and able to work with limited supervision. Willing and able to travel frequently. Willing to work occasional overtime, evenings, or weekends when project schedules require it. Valid driver's license and acceptable driving record required. Ability to meet applicable customer and job-site requirements. Physical Requirements Ability to lift and carry up to 50 lbs. Ability to work from ladders and lifts. Ability to bend, kneel, climb, reach, and work in various field environments. Ability to work indoors and outdoors depending on the project. Travel Requirements This is a traveling technician position. Candidates must be comfortable with frequent overnight travel and working at project sites outside their local area. Travel schedules will vary based on project needs and may include multi-day or extended assignments.
